01 · Overview
What Wormi is
Wormi is a pixel creature game on Robinhood Chain. You lock at least 100,000 WORMI to hatch a Wormi, an NFT whose art lives fully onchain.
Every Wormi has a weight: the WORMI locked inside it plus twice the WORMI you burn to feed it. Every WORMI trade pays a creator fee in NVDA, which the creator wallet forwards to the reward vault, and every Wormi earns its weight's share of each fee that reaches the vault, from the moment it hatches.
Heavier Wormis evolve through four tiers. Tiers change the look only; rewards always follow weight.

05 · FAQ
Questions players ask
What do I earn?
NVDA, the tokenized NVIDIA stock on Robinhood Chain. Each Wormi earns its weight's share of every creator fee that reaches the vault, from the moment it hatches. Claim on a Wormi to settle it and receive everything you are due.
Where do rewards come from?
From the creator fee on every WORMI trade. The fee is paid in NVDA, the creator wallet forwards it to the RewardVault, and the NVDA in the vault is split across all living Wormis by weight. Nothing is printed and nothing is promised.
Can I get my WORMI back?
Yes, the locked part. Once a Wormi is at least 3 days old you can release it: the Wormi is destroyed and its locked WORMI returns to you. WORMI burned while feeding never returns.
Why does burning count double?
Burned WORMI is gone for good, while locked WORMI can come back. Counting a burn twice rewards the player who gives up that option, and it shrinks the WORMI supply for everyone.
What happens if I sell my Wormi?
The Wormi moves with everything attached: its weight, its locked WORMI and any rewards not yet claimed. The new owner can claim them. Claim before you sell if you want to keep them.
What if trading is quiet?
Then few fees arrive and rewards slow down. Your Wormi keeps its weight and its share, so it earns again the moment trading picks up.
Is there a claim all button?
No. Claim works on one Wormi at a time. Withdraw pays NVDA that is already settled, for example from Wormis you released.
Who controls the contracts?
Nobody controls the Wormi contracts. There is no admin, no owner key and no upgrade path, and the RewardVault has no owner and only pays what Wormis have earned. The creator fee that fills the vault is forwarded by the creator wallet, as the risks below explain.
